Sir Michael Caine CBE (born Maurice Joseph Micklewhite; 14 March 1933) is an English retired actor. [2] Known for his distinctive Cockney accent, [3] he has appeared in more than 160 films over a career that spanned eight decades and is considered a British film icon.

Jul 22, 2024 · Michael Caine (born March 14, 1933, London, England) is an internationally successful British actor renowned for his versatility in numerous leading and character roles. He appeared in more than 100 films, and his amiable Cockney persona was usually present in each performance.
